Misconceptions Regarding Cataract Surgical Procedure
If you're considering cataract surgery, it's essential to separate reality from fiction when it concerns usual misconceptions surrounding this procedure.
One widespread myth is that cataracts require to be "ripe" before surgical treatment can be done. cataract surgery over 60 is not true. Cataracts do not require to reach a particular level of maturity prior to removal; they can be eliminated as soon as they start influencing your vision substantially.
Another mistaken belief is that cataract surgical procedure hurts. In truth, the procedure is commonly pain-free because of the numbing eye declines and sedatives utilized throughout the surgical procedure.
Some people additionally think that cataracts can expand back after surgery. While the natural lens can not expand back, some patients may experience cloudiness months or years after surgical treatment as a result of a problem called posterior capsule opacity, which can quickly be fixed with a quick laser procedure.
It is very important to unmask these misconceptions to make educated choices concerning cataract surgical procedure.
Realities Behind Cataract Surgery
Let's now clarify the realities about cataract surgery. Cataract surgical procedure is one of the most typical and effective procedures performed worldwide. It's a secure and efficient surgical treatment with a high success price in boosting vision and lifestyle. The procedure entails removing the gloomy lens and changing it with a synthetic intraocular lens, bring back clear vision.
Cataract surgery is normally an outpatient procedure, implying you can go home the very same day. The recovery time is relatively fast, with many individuals experiencing boosted vision within a couple of days. cataract surgery types of lenses to feel some mild discomfort or itching in the eye after surgery, however this normally resolves promptly.
Modern cataract surgical procedure strategies have advanced dramatically, leading to minimal issues and faster recovery times. The surgical procedure is executed under local anesthetic, and you'll be awake during the treatment, yet you won't feel any type of pain.
